after his initial release on world unknown records way back in 2011 - a tunethat featured on andrew weatherall s ministry of sound masterpiece 2012 compilation - kalidasa has also released music via magic feet and tusk wax. this latest release sees him ploughing along a similar musical line. the mirage and sun aki are both tracks for those who like to chug-along to the more refined, no frills tunes that do exactly what they say on the tin. both are perfect spaced out and otherworldly grooves for strobe filled and lazer infused dark basements. soft rocks throw around some magical dust on the flip for their sun goes up, sun goes down remix which sees them turn the mirage into a 9 minute time lapse venturing from an early morning ambient start through to a pulsating electronic drive through the stars.

former world unknown and magic feet contributor kalidasa steps up for duty on the tusk wax label. usual rules apply: strictly limited 180g 12 inch vinyl, hand stamped, individually numbered, no digital. kalidasa reveals himself to be on a par with president of chug prins thomas across the four sprawling slabs of psychedelic electronic disco here. hard to choose one track over another but the >spectrum of love mix< of molly cules really hits the spot.

the third release on the world unknown label is a very meaty affair that coincides with the second birthday of the club night in brixton. on side w timothy j. fairplay fuses ancient egypt with late 80s belgium and drops it slap bang into the near future with the monolithic techno beast that is >cleopatra loves the acid<. its already been played in discos and on the bbc by andrew weatherall, for whom tim handles engineering and co-production duties in his day job, and is set to become a pounding anthem on the more adventurous dancefloors over the coming months. side u is a more throbbing psychedelic affair. kalidasa is the production alter-ego of tim rivers who runs the always excellent theacidhouse.com website. it<s exactly the kind of heavyweight midtempo tune that causes sweaty pandemonium at world unknown. if the word balearic still meant now what it did to from 87-92 then thats precisely what youd call this, most likely with the prefix >heavy<. but it doesnt so you cant, or can you?

various lurkers includes 4 mega tracks beamed down from brighton, leeds & sweden featuring kalidasa, zmatsutsi, tony pineman & tross. wicked collection of krautrock inspired chuggers, dubbed out disco and weirdo balearic beats. must have for fans of music from memory, invisible inc, optimo etc
